In the Batken region, over 1.4 million tons of coal were mined in a year

According to the report provided by the representative office of the Batken region, the total amount of coal mined in 2025 was 1 million 401 thousand tons.

The distribution of production volumes by districts is as follows:

In the Kadamjai district, 960 thousand tons of coal were mined from three deposits in the rural area of Maidan, which accounts for 68.5% of the total volume in the region.

In Suluktu, 46 coal mines produced 430.8 thousand tons of coal, which accounts for 30.7% of the total volume.

The Batken district reported a production of 46.6 thousand tons.

The Leilek district contributed an additional 3.2 thousand tons to the total amount.

It should be noted that there is a high demand for coal from Suluktu in the domestic market. However, coal mined at the Bel-Alma deposit, located in the Kadamjai district, is mainly supplied to the Osh and Jalal-Abad regions due to logistical peculiarities.
